who devise

To cut, inscribe, or engrave (on stone, wood, or metal); to plow, to incise or form furrows in soil; (by extension) to fabricate or craft, particularly as an artisan or smith. In figurative use: to devise, plot, or plan (usually with negative connotations); to be silent or keep silent, especially in a deliberate or calculated manner; to be deaf (rare, possibly as a secondary development from 'not hearing' in the sense of silence). The semantic range covers both physical acts of craftsmanship and cultivation, as well as actions of secret planning, contrivance, or silence.

Morphological NotesQal active participle, masculine plural, construct state.
Rendering RationaleThe Qal active participle masculine plural in construct denotes "ones who are cutting/engraving/plowing" in relation to what follows. "Cutting ones of" preserves the root’s core idea of incision or carving while reflecting the masculine plural participial and construct form.

RationaleP1 'cutting ones of' is root-faithful but contextually the figurative sense 'devisers of' (those who plot/plan) is demanded, especially with a negative object. Adjusted for contextual sense per lexicon.
